STATE v. MURRAY

No. 103,773.

271 P.3d 739 (2012)

293 Kan. 1051

STATE of Kansas, Appellee, v. Randall A. MURRAY, Appellant.

Supreme Court of Kansas.

March 2, 2012.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ael J. Bartee , of Michael J. Bartee, P.A., of Olathe, was on the brief for appellant.

Jerome A. Gorman , district attorney, and Derek Schmidt , attorney general, was with him on the brief for appellee.


The opinion of the court was delivered by

BEIER, J.

Defendant Randall Murray appeals the denial of his motion to correct an illegal sentence for his 28-year-old convictions of aggravated robbery and felony murder. He argues that he did not receive a required competency hearing and thus the district court lacked jurisdiction to try and sentence him. We reverse the district court's decision summarily denying Murray's motion and remand for an evidentiary hearing...
